Company Description
Backed by leading climate and American dynamism investors, Terranova builds intelligent robotic systems to terraform the Earth itself - lifting land, restoring wetlands, and protecting critical infrastructure from floods and sea-level rise.
Our mission is to preserve the built environment, create new habitats, and usher in an era of abundance. Our work supports climate resilience, disaster recovery, and defense across the United States and beyond.
We’re assembling a world-class team that wants to work on something real, physical, and civilization-scale. If you want your work to reshape the world (literally), this is the place to do it.
What to to Expect
Terranova seeks a Senior Electrical Engineer to join our core engineering team. The ideal candidate has a passion for their craft and can go deep on design and analysis while maintaining a systems-level view across electrical, embedded, and controls disciplines. This person thrives in a startup environment - owning problems end-to-end, moving fast, and building machines that survive the real world.
You’ll lead projects from concept through field deployment: designing, analyzing, fabricating, and testing large-scale robotic systems that operate in the most demanding environments on Earth. Expect to be hands-on, spend long hours in the factory and in the field working alongside technicians and operators.
Key Responsibilities
Own all aspects of electrical design, analysis, controls integration, and component/supplier selection
Understand high power systems (150+ kW) and ensure safe design
Lead design reviews and guide projects through prototyping, testing, and initial production
Collaborate closely with electrical, controls, and field teams to deliver integrated, field-ready systems
Design custom PCBs and circuit boards for development
Drive failure analysis, testing, and iterative improvement based on real-world data
Preferred Skills and Experience
4+ years of electrical engineering experience in machinery, robotics, or heavy equipment
Hands-on prototyping skills - you enjoy working in the shop
Experience in electromechanical controls - VFDs
Experience in high voltage AC power conversion systems and lithium batteries
VFD control and setup
PCB and embedded systems design skills (Altium or equivalent)
Comfortable with the pace and intensity of early-stage startup life, including long days, 6-day workweeks, and extended field hours
Bachelor’s degree or higher in Electrical Engineering or related field
U.S. permanent residency required
Nice to Have Skills
CAD proficiency (OnShape, SolidWorks, Fusion 360, or NX)
Familiarity with C++, Python, or similar for controls or simulation
Proven project management capabilities with multiple concurrent workstreams
Experience with compliance, HAZOP, and FMEA tools for machine safety
Ideal Archetype
Have worked on large complex outdoor high power systems - ideally large robots, electric, large motors, many sensors
OSHA compliance familiarity for construction equipment
Maker background - love building stuff, work is fun to you
Coming from a startup environment - high ownership, fast paced environment
